Non-Domestic Rating Act 2023

19Commencement and application

(1)The following provisions come into force on the day on which this Act is passed—

(a)sections 1 to 6, 9, 14, 15(3)(b) and (c)(i), 16, 17(1)(a) and (2) to (10), 18, and 20,

(b)this section, and

(c)Parts 1 and 2 of the Schedule.

(2)The amendments made by the following provisions have effect in relation to financial years beginning on or after 1 April 2024—

(a)sections 1 to 3, and

(b)Part 1 of the Schedule.

(3)Sections 7 and 11 come into force at the end of the period of two months beginning with the day on which this Act is passed.

(4)The following provisions come into force in accordance with provision contained in regulations made by the appropriate national authority—

(a)sections 10, 12 and 13(2), (4) and (6) (and section 13(1) so far as relating to those subsections), and

(b)paragraphs 39(a), 46, 49(c) and (d), 50 and 53(a) of Part 4 of the Schedule (and section 17(1)(d) and paragraph 40 of the Schedule so far as relating to those paragraphs).

(5)Section 15(3)(a), (c)(ii), (d) and (4) (and section 15(1) so far as relating to those subsections) come into force in accordance with provision contained in regulations by the Welsh Ministers.

(6)The remaining provisions of this Act come into force in accordance with provision contained in regulations made by the Secretary of State.

(7)The appropriate national authority may by regulations make transitional, transitory or saving provision in connection with the coming into force of any provision of this Act.

(8)The power to make regulations under subsection (7) includes power to make different provision for different purposes.

(9)A power to make regulations under this section is exercisable by statutory instrument.

(10)In this section—

  • the appropriate national authority” means—

    (a)

    in relation to England, the Secretary of State;

    (b)

    in relation to Wales, the Welsh Ministers;

  • financial year” means a period of 12 months beginning with 1 April.
